Para ver el artículo en inglés, active la casilla Inglés. También puede ver el texto en inglés en una ventana emergente si pasa el puntero del mouse por el texto.
Traducción
Inglés
Esta documentación está archivada y no tiene mantenimiento.

UIElement.InputBindings (Propiedad)

Obtiene la colección de enlaces de entrada asociada a este elemento.

Espacio de nombres:  System.Windows
Ensamblado:  PresentationCore (en PresentationCore.dll)
XMLNS para XAML: http://schemas.microsoft.com/winfx/2006/xaml/presentation, http://schemas.microsoft.com/netfx/2007/xaml/presentation

public InputBindingCollection InputBindings { get; }
<object>
  <object.InputBindings>
    oneOrMoreInputBindings
  </object.InputBindings>
</object>

Valores XAML

oneOrMoreInputBindings

Uno o varios elementos InputBinding (normalmente las clases derivadas de KeyBinding o MouseBinding). Se supone que cada uno de estos elementos tiene establecidos los atributos Command y Gesture.

Valor de propiedad

Tipo: System.Windows.Input.InputBindingCollection
Colección de enlaces de entrada.

Los enlaces de entrada admiten el enlace de comandos a los dispositivos de entrada. Por ejemplo, MouseBinding implementa enlaces de entrada que incluyen propiedades específicas de los dispositivos de mouse.

La colección de enlaces de entrada incluye los enlaces de entrada que pertenecen al tipo y los que se declaran en la instancia.

Una propiedad relacionada, CommandBindings, mantiene una colección de enlaces de comando. Éstos difieren de los enlaces de entrada en que representan el siguiente nivel inferior del procesamiento de comandos, es decir, las acciones enlazadas a los comandos conocidos.

El ejemplo siguiente rellena esta propiedad en Window, con un único objeto KeyBinding.


<Window.InputBindings>
  <KeyBinding Key="B"
              Modifiers="Control" 
              Command="ApplicationCommands.Open" />
</Window.InputBindings>


Para obtener más información sobre la sintaxis de XAML para colecciones, vea Detalles de la sintaxis XAML.

.NET Framework

Compatible con: 4, 3.5, 3.0

.NET Framework Client Profile

Compatible con: 4, 3.5 SP1

Windows 7, Windows Vista SP1 o posterior, Windows XP SP3, Windows Server 2008 (no se admite Server Core), Windows Server 2008 R2 (se admite Server Core con SP1 o posterior), Windows Server 2003 SP2

.NET Framework no admite todas las versiones de todas las plataformas. Para obtener una lista de las versiones compatibles, vea Requisitos de sistema de .NET Framework.
Mostrar: